Free vs Paid Backlink Indexer: What Should You Choose? Choosing between a free and paid backlink indexer sounds simple until you start looking at real SEO campaigns. If you only publish pages on your own website, free tools may be enough for a large part of your workflow. But if you build guest posts, citations, niche edits, profile links, PR mentions, or affiliate backlinks on third-party websites, the decision becomes more complicated. A backlink can be live and still not be discovered quickly. The page may exist, your link may be visible, and the campaign may look complete from the outside, but Google still needs to crawl and evaluate the source page. If that does not happen, the backlink may take longer to support your SEO work. This is where the free vs paid backlink indexer decision matters. Free options are useful when you control the website.
